Algae can be a problem with diesel, and so can cumulative contamination from those Jerry Jugs that never quite get emptied, and never quite get cleaned. There is much wisdom is taking a sample of the diesel you are about to buy, and putting it into a narrow glass or clear plastic container...check for color and clarity, then let it sit while you have a beer, to see what settles to the bottom. Main tanks should be completely drained and flushed periodically, and if you can avoid drawing from the bottom of the tank.. so much the better. Rough conditions and low fuel levels just up the odds. Your fuel filter(s) and water separator are your second line of defense ( although we think of them as Primary.. but checking and rough filtering your fuel before it ever gets into the ship's tank is really the primary check, so that contaminated or funky diesel never ever gets into your tanks . One of my favorite tools.. is a cheap ($10) battery operated fuel transfer pump ( harbor freight and various mail order outfits). It is meant to pump from 5 gal Jerry Cans, transfers about 1.5 gallons per minute.. wont spill a drop if you are not blind drunk...and best of all you never have to stir up the contents in the jug by up-ending it. So unless things are rough. let the jugs sit and settle, and them use the pump... which wont take the last (dregs) unless you force it. runs on couple of D cells.. use rechargables and solar to save waste and cost. Brilliant tool. Get 2 ! Some biocide will stop algae growth, and even cloth and funnel filtration will remove much of it. Draining that see through water seperator/filter and changing the element.. needs to be a religious observation.

very interesting to see that contaminated diesel, i have never seen it so dirty. Nice fix, good job! The real reason that the prop shaft needs to be scrubbed clean is because the zinc needs to make good electrical(!) contact. Otherwise the principle of sacrificial corrosion doesn't work.

You should probably have your fuel tank professionally cleaned. Always use BioBor diesel biocide and a Baja filter when fueling. Your engine will always be unreliable unless you do.
@stephenburnage76872 жыл бұрын
It is hard to get professional cleaning out of the US. What I do is empty my fuel tank regularly by pumping everything through the filter and into a spare can (before changing the filter). Better to discover what you have in the bottom of your tank when in harbor.
@leeoldershaw9562 жыл бұрын
@@stephenburnage7687 once the algae gets going it coats all the surfaces in the tank. Even if you kill it the particles will shed a long time clogging filters quickly. Buy a case of filters.

Real quality time with parents. I feel very privileged to be able to join in. Incidentally, I still don’t think that you run the engine with the key in the right position. Click to on and then to start and then it should spring back to the run/on position. If you then turn it back to the off position then the alternator is not energised and it won’t charge the batteries. I guess a volt meter would tell you if you are charging or not. Re fuel bacteria, I am told that there must be water present for it to survive. Try and keep it dry in there, he said helpfully! Go well you intrepid free spirit. 👍
